The Center for Innovation in Teaching & Learning (CITL) along with campus partners from The University Library, Technology Services, NCSA, ATLAS and The Siebel Center for Design will host the Summer of AI at the University of Illinois Urbana-Champaign. Throughout this summer-long series faculty and staff will have the opportunity to participate in hands-on workshops, guest talks, and conversations on how AI impacts the future of teaching and learning.

This hands-on, hybrid, beginners’ workshop will introduce participants to image (still and moving) generating AIs.  We will explore their features and capabilities and apply them in higher education settings.  You will learn how to safely streamline your work, reduce production time, and easily generate visual aids for your classroom needs.  The discussion will include the many-sided practical, legal and ethical considerations of AI use, with an eye towards its future place in higher educationOfficial Illinois tools will be featured prominently. These sessions will be held in Armory room 156 and online via Zoom, please bring your laptop.
